


DATAPRINT selected for the CHIMERES program
We were awarded the prestigious CHIMÈRES Residency at Le Lieu Unique in Nantes, France, administered by the French Ministry of Culture, Théâtre Nouvelle Generation, and Le Lieu Unique. The residency brought together 12 artists working at the intersection of hybrid arts, tech & immersive performance. DATAPRINT was one of 3 projects selected to continue with the CHIMÈRES program and receive additional developmental support.
DATAPRINT Team returns at Princeton University
The DATAPRINT team recently gathered for our second residency at Princeton University, during which we focused on narrative design. David Kuelz, narrative game designer and the lead writer for DATAPRINT, led this residency and we are well on our way to completing a draft of the narrative structure of the piece.
KAIMERA at IETM Hull
Kaimera has recently become a member of IETM, an international network for contemporary performing arts. Between 28-31 March 2019, Simón Adinia Hanukai went on behalf of our team to the most recent convening in Hull, UK, where he presented our SPACES project at a Newsround. The next IETM convening will take place in Rijeka, Croatia, in October 2019, where Simón was invited to facilitate a session on Immersive Creative Processes.
